#69b30d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#69b30d is composed of 41.2% red, 70.2%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.7%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 86.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 37.6%. #69b30d color hex could be obtained by blending #d2ff1a with #006700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#69b30d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080e01 is the darkest color, while #fdf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#69b30d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#60625e is the less saturated color, while #6aba06 is the most saturated one.
